The type of electromagnetic waves commonly used for Radiographic Testing is X-rays. X-rays have the ability to penetrate various materials, including body tissue and metals, making them extremely useful for medical imaging and industrial non-destructive testing. They have shorter wavelengths than microwaves, which results in higher frequency and energy levels. This property allows X-rays to reveal the internal structure of objects by creating an image on photographic film or a digital sensor as they pass through different materials with varying degrees of absorption. In the electromagnetic spectrum, X-rays fall between ultraviolet radiation and gamma rays in terms of frequency and energy.
It is important to understand that radiography leverages the higher energy of X-rays to inspect the integrity of materials and structures without causing damage to the object being inspected, which is why this type of electromagnetic radiation is selected for such applications.
